Types of Daycares:
There are many different kinds of daycares offered, each catering to various needs and preferences. Some typically common types of daycares feature:

  1. In-home Daycares: These are usually run by a person or family members in their own home. They offer a far more intimate setting with a lower child-to-caregiver proportion.

  1. Childcare Centers: they are bigger facilities that cater to a bigger wide range of kiddies. They could provide even more structured programs and activities.

  1. Preschools: These are much like childcare facilities but focus more about very early education and college ability.

  1. Montessori Schools: These schools follow the Montessori method of education, which emphasizes autonomy, self-directed learning, and hands-on tasks.

Services Offered:
Daycares offer a selection of solutions to meet up the requirements of working parents and provide a nurturing environment for the kids. Some traditional solutions provided by daycares feature:

  1. Full-day treatment: Many daycares offer full-day take care of working parents, offering treatment from early morning until night.

  1. Part-time attention: Some daycares offer part-time treatment options for parents which just need look after a few days per week or a couple of hours per day.

  1. Early training: numerous daycares offer early training programs that give attention to college readiness and cognitive development.

  1. Healthy meals: Some daycares provide naturally healthy dishes and treats for the kids through the day.

Facilities:
The facilities at a daycare play a crucial role in offering a secure and stimulating environment for the kids. Some factors to consider whenever evaluating daycare facilities include:

  1. Cleanliness: The daycare should-be neat and well-maintained to guarantee the safe practices regarding the young ones.

  1. Security precautions: The daycare need to have safety measures in position, eg childproofing, protected entrances, and disaster processes.

  1. Play areas: The daycare needs to have age-appropriate play places and equipment for the kids to engage in physical activity and play.

  1. Mastering materials: The daycare needs a variety of discovering products, books, and toys to promote cognitive development and creativity.

Prices:
The expense of daycare can vary according to the sort of daycare, location, and solutions offered. Some factors that may influence the expense of daycare include:

  1. Form of Daycare Near Me By State: In-home daycares might be more affordable than childcare facilities or preschools.

  1. Area: Daycares in cities or high-cost-of-living areas could have greater costs.

  1. Services offered: Daycares offering extra solutions, particularly early education programs or meals, could have higher charges.

  1. Subsidies: Some people can be eligible for subsidies or financial assistance to assist protect the cost of daycare.
